About 305,000 cars produced in Q1.
Estimating 260,000 cars for Q2.

Given that it appears we are now already exceeding the fancy 1.5M cars/yr production rate (375k/qtr), where do we stand for the year relative to everyone’s expectations on production rate?

The steep portion of the S curve for both Austin and Berlin are coming in H2 2022.

If we assume Q3 averages 2.5k cars per week in Berlin and Austin averages 2k cars per week, and Q4 shows 3.5 and 3 respectively, that’s an extra 132,000 cars from them in H2.

Fremont at 600k/yr gives us an additional 300k for H2.

Shanghai at 72k/month average for H2 gives us 432k for H2…

300+432+132+305+260 and I get roughly 1.43M cars this year.

Sprinkle a little Elon magic in there and I think we’ll be just shy of 1.5M cars for 2022.
